Blake Shelton Speaks Out About Personal Duet With Gwen Stefani


Things have really been heating up between Blake Shelton and Gwen Stefani. ET Online got the chance to talk to Blake about his new album, and word is out that he has a duet with Gwen on his album If I’m Honest. The news about their duet was revealed by Gwen as she went to her Twitter page to share the news about their big duet.

Fans were really excited when they found out that Blake would have a song with Gwen on his album. It is called “Go Ahead and Break My Heart,” but the two have been able to keep the details quiet. Blake shared that it was his idea for her to announce the duet that way. Shelton said, “We finally got a mock-up of the album, what the artwork was going to look like. And we flip it over and it has all the songs. I said, ‘You know what? Take a picture of that and tweet it.”

This song is not just one that Blake Shelton and Gwen Stefani sing together on, though. They actually worked on writing the song together as well. Blake shared the details and why this song is so important to him.

“[The song] is very personal for us both because, you know, we obviously have this bond that is remarkable together. But the fact that we wrote a song together… I know that I don’t co-write that much because I’m very insecure about it I guess and [Gwen’s] kind of got her circle of people that she writes with. But for us to reach out to each other as writers, it may never happen again, who knows.”

Blake Shelton didn’t want to brag too much, but he does think this is a great song. Nobody has got the chance to hear this one just yet. It won’t be very much longer, though. Blake Shelton’s album If I’m Honest will be hitting stores on May 20.

Things have really been heating up for Blake Shelton and Gwen Stefani. Radar Online reported that Blake was recently seen out with Gwen and her son Apollo. They were leaving a children’s gym and Blake was holding hands with the little boy. This was just a few days after Gwen’s divorce from Gavin Rossdale was finalized.

Blake Shelton and Gwen Stefani met on The Voice, and they were both going through a divorce at the same time. Gwen filed for divorce from Gavin Rossdale after 13 years of marriage and Blake divorced Miranda Lambert after just four years of marriage. Gwen had a hard time with her divorce and shared her thoughts.

“I did not think anything. I wasn’t thinking. I was feeling and I was dying. And then I was just like, You can’t go down like this! You have to turn this into music. You have to try, at least. I was so embarrassed by just everything. I just didn’t want to be that person that just went down after all of that.”

Gwen Stefani and Blake Shelton found each other and were able to bond over their divorce. It looks like things might work out in the end. Blake seems happy with Gwen and Miranda has moved on to start dating Anderson East since their big split.
